Ounces of Prevention, Pounds of Cure
- 2/21/2012
|
When children grow up with access to good foods, reliable nutrition, and opportunities to get out and play, they develop early on what they need for lifelong health. But Texas faces a growing and costly challenge: more and more of our kids are growing up overweight, obese, and at risk for serious disease.
What are we doing as a state to address childhood obesity? And what are our elected leaders doing about a challenge that is making too many Texas kids miss out on a healthy start?
In this publication, made possible with support from Methodist Healthcare Ministries, we look back at the actions of the most recent Texas legislature--where our state moved forward, where we held the line, and where Texas retreated--in efforts to tip the scales toward a healthier future. We also offer what Texas can do next, so children and communities have what they need for a healthier life.
